This page presents the sentiments and expectations of households and firms (small and medium businesses) in Belarus. The data is obtained from surveys. The consumer confidence index provides an insight of the future development of household consumption and savings, based on their current assessments and forecasts of their financial condition and the country’s economy, as well as their propensity to buy durable goods.
According to the quarterly household monitoring data, the Consumer Confidence Index — along with its components — slightly decreased and amounted to -4.8% (under the Rosstat methodology) in May 2024.
